摘要

Abstract

In response to the challenges of quantitative sampling under negative pressure,low real-time detection accuracy of moisture content,and poor stability during the cotton processing,an online moisture content detection device for lint cotton was developed based on the resistance method.A novel online detection method,combining"dynamic quantitative sampling—weight constant pressure measuremen—multi-parameter compensation"was proposed.Key components,including a flip-type sampling mechanism and weight detection system,were designed to achieve stable sampling and continuous detection of lint cotton in a high-speed flow state.Based on the electrical resistance characteristics of lint cotton and environmental temperature and humidity data,a multi-parameter moisture content prediction model was constructed.After comparing various algorithms,the random forest model was identified as the most accurate predictor,with a coefficient of determination(R2)of 0.98 and a root mean square error(RMSE)of 0.22%.Performance validation tests showed that the average deviation between the proposed online detection device and the standard measurement instrument was 0.1%,with an average detection time of 23.4 s per sample.The impact of sample weight on the moisture content measurement results was weak(Pearson correlation coefficient was 0.47).The experimental results demonstrated that the device offered high detection accuracy and good stability,meeting the real-time and accuracy requirements for moisture content detection in cotton processing.This device can provide reliable technical support for intelligent regulation and quality traceability in the cotton processing industry.
